What are regulations for Ventilations on ships as per SOLAS ?

(i) constructed of steel having a tickles of at least 3 mm and 5 mm for ducts the widths or diameters of which are up to and including 300 mm and 760 mm and above respectively and, in the case of such ducts, the widths of diameters of which are between 300 mm and 760 mm having a tickles to be obtained by interpolation.                 (ii) Suitably supported and stiffene                                                                                                         (iii) Fitted with automatic fire dampers close to the boundaries penetrated; and   (iv)Insulated to A-60 standard from the machinery spaces, galleys, car deck spaces Ro/Ro cargo spaces or special category spaces to a point at least 5 m beyond each fire damper;
